Hyperpyrexia?
**Core Concept**
Hyperpyrexia refers to an extremely high fever, typically above 106°F (41.1°C), that can cause damage to the brain, heart, and other organs. This condition is often a medical emergency and requires prompt treatment to prevent serious complications.
**Why the Correct Answer is Right**
Hyperpyrexia occurs due to the body's inability to regulate its temperature, leading to a rapid rise in body temperature. This can be caused by various factors, including infections, medication overdoses, or CNS disorders. The hypothalamus, the body's temperature regulation center, becomes overwhelmed, leading to a loss of temperature homeostasis. In severe cases, hyperpyrexia can cause seizures, coma, and even death.
